FSharpAux


Double

Namespace: FSharpAux
Parent Module: Seq

Seq module extensions specialized for seq

Functions and values

Function or valueDescription
existsNaN(sq)
Signature: sq:seq<float> -> bool

Returns true if sequence contains nan

existsNanBy f sq
Signature: f:('a -> float) -> sq:seq<'a> -> bool
Type parameters: 'a
filterInfinity(sq)
Signature: sq:seq<float> -> seq<float>
filterInfinityBy f sq
Signature: f:('a -> float) -> sq:seq<'a> -> seq<'a>
Type parameters: 'a
filterNaN(sq)
Signature: sq:seq<float> -> seq<float>
filterNanAndInfinity(sq)
Signature: sq:seq<float> -> seq<float>
filterNanAndInfinityBy f sq
Signature: f:('a -> float) -> sq:seq<'a> -> seq<'a>
Type parameters: 'a
filterNanBy f sq
Signature: f:('a -> float) -> sq:seq<'a> -> seq<'a>
Type parameters: 'a
seqInit from tto length
Signature: from:float -> tto:float -> length:float -> seq<float>

Generates sequence (like R! seq.int)

seqInitStepWidth from tto stepWidth
Signature: from:float -> tto:float -> stepWidth:float -> seq<float>

Generates sequence given step width (like R! seq)

Fork me on GitHub